причем при значениях X от 0,1 до 2,0 уголь относят к опасному по склонности к самовозгоранию, при значениях X от 2,0 до 2,5 - к малоопасному, а при X более 2,5 - к неопасному.A method for assessing the propensity of coal for spontaneous combustion, including an analysis of the moisture content of the selected coal samples, characterized in that the moisture content in the mesopores and micropores is determined, and a mathematical formula is used to assess the propensity for spontaneous combustion
where W meso - the moisture content in the mesopores,%;
W micro - moisture content in micropores,%;
X is an indicator of the propensity of coal for spontaneous combustion,
moreover, with values of X from 0.1 to 2.0 coal is classified as dangerous in propensity to spontaneous combustion, with values of X from 2.0 to 2.5 - low hazard, and with X more than 2.5 - non-hazardous.
